Position on the Tree of Life

Path 29 connects Malkuth (10) to Netzach (7), bridging the physical world with the sphere of victory and emotion. It is the twenty-ninth step in the Key Scale, following Path 28 (Tzaddi) and preceding Path 30 (Resh).

Astrological and planetary correspondence

In the system of Liber 777, Path 29 corresponds to the zodiacal sign Pisces (♓), the Fishes, ruled by Neptune (in modern astrology) and Jupiter (in traditional attribution). This aligns with the watery, dreamy, and mutable nature of Qoph, which governs the subconscious, dreams, and the depths of the ocean.

The Tarot card associated with this path is The Moon (Atu XVIII), which depicts a path leading between two towers, a dog and wolf howling at the moon, and a scorpion emerging from water—all symbols of the hidden, instinctual forces that Qoph governs.

In the table of Liber 777, the number 29 appears as the Key Scale value for Path 29, alongside its Hebrew letter Qoph, the zodiac sign Pisces, and the Tarot trump The Moon.
